The size of Ryde is approximately 7.1 square kilometres. It has 45 parks covering nearly 11.7% of total area. The population of Ryde in 2016 was 26499 people. By 2021 the population was 31907 showing a population growth of 20.4% in the area during that time. The predominant age group in Ryde is 30-39 years. Households in Ryde are primarily couples with children and are likely to be repaying over $4000 per month on mortgage repayments. In general, people in Ryde work in a professional occupation.In 2021, 52.00% of the homes in Ryde were owner-occupied compared with 55.60% in 2016.
Ryde has 15,946 properties. Over the last 5 years, Houses in Ryde have seen a 37.73% increase in median value, while Units have seen a 9.75% increase. As at 31 March 2026:
